AGRICULTURAL processor and food ingredient provider, Archer Daniels Midland Company will purchase 50% stake in Medsofts Group, a privately based company in Cairo. The parties agreed that the joint venture will own and manage merchandising and supply chain operations, which includes an international merchandising operation that handles more than 1.5 million metric tons of grains, oilseeds and soft commodities annually destined for the Middle East and North Africa; a local grain distribution operation, serving customers in Egypt; and an inland logistics network that links port operations to customers throughout Egypt.
The JV will own a 50% share of Nile Stevedoring & Storage Co. (NSSC) in Port of Alexandria, Egypt. The facility has an annual discharge capacity of more than 2 million metric tons, and includes additional land for future expansion; the joint venture parties are conducting advanced due diligence on a potential oilseed crush facility on that land.
This investment widens ADM’s foothold in the EMEA supply chain, and will help the company grow its logistics services, and enhance marketing capabilities, according to Joe Taets, president of ADM’s Agricultural Services business unit, and president of the company’s EMEA operations.
